What is the total acreage of FOTA?

Fota Wildlife Park, which is a member of the Zoological Society of Ireland and can be found on Fota Island around 10 kilometers east of Cork City, is situated on 100 acres and has an annual attendance of approximately 460,000 people.

Who was the original founder of Fota Wildlife Park?

The President of Ireland, Dr. Patrick Hillery, officially opened Fota Wildlife Park in July 1983. The primary objective of the park is the conservation of species across the world. The Zoological Society of Ireland and University College Cork have collaborated on this initiative to bring it to fruition. More than 70 different kinds of rare and unusual animals can be found roaming free at the Fota Wildlife Park.

When did Fota Wildlife Park first open its doors?

When more funds became available, buildings were constructed, and in the fall of 1982, the first animals were brought in. The park first opened its gates to the general public in the summer of 1983, and since then, it has seen an increase in the number of visitors to the tune of hundreds of thousands annually.

Is there a chance of seeing flamingos on Fota Island?

The Relationship with Fota

However, because of Fota Island’s location, its Chilean flamingoes not only live in a very appropriate natural environment, but they can also fish and supplement their own diet. The bird is susceptible to developing lesions or Bumblefoot in captivity when it is housed in fresh water habitats.
